SSRS日期参数



请有人可以对下面的情况提供一些见解?

我正在寻找一个日期表达式(下个月的最后一天),我想在"结束日期参数"上使用它。

我有以下表达式,但由于某种原因,它仅显示我只显示30天(例如一月而不是2017年3月31日,它显示为30/01/2017)

=dateadd("m",2,dateserial(year(Today),month(Today),0))

问候

satya

替代:

=dateadd(dateinterval.day, -1, dateserial(year(today()), month(today())+2, 1))

在两个月的时间内完成本月开始的时间,然后花一天的时间。您也可以使用:

=dateadd(dateinterval.second, -1, dateserial(year(today()), month(today())+2, 1))

如果您想要那天结束(23:59:59)

找到了我问题的解决方案,这里是

=今天。adddays(1-today.day).addmonths(2).adddays(-1)

相关内容

  • 没有找到相关文章

最新更新